无论是中小型企业还是大型集团,数据的安全与完整性直接关系到业务的稳定运行和持续发展
对于使用易语言进行开发的企业而言,ACCESS数据库作为一种轻量级、易于操作的关系型数据库管理系统,广泛应用于各类应用系统中
然而,数据风险无处不在,硬件故障、人为错误、病毒攻击等因素都可能导致数据丢失或损坏
因此,定期进行ACCESS数据库的备份工作,成为了保障数据安全、提升业务连续性的重要措施
本文将深入探讨易语言环境下ACCESS数据库备份的重要性、实施方法以及最佳实践,旨在为企业提供一套全面而有效的数据保护方案
一、ACCESS数据库备份的重要性 1.防范数据丢失:数据库是信息系统的核心组成部分,存储着大量的业务数据
一旦数据库发生损坏或被删除,将直接影响业务的正常运行,甚至导致无法挽回的经济损失
定期备份数据库,可以在数据丢失时迅速恢复,最大限度地减少损失
2.保障业务连续性:在遭遇突发事件(如自然灾害、系统故障)时,快速恢复数据库服务是确保业务连续性的关键
有效的备份策略能够缩短系统恢复时间,减少业务中断的影响,维护企业的信誉和客户关系
3.符合法规要求:许多行业和地区都有关于数据保护和隐私的法律条款,要求企业定期备份敏感数据,以备监管机构审查或应对法律诉讼
ACCESS数据库备份不仅是技术需求,也是合规要求
4.支持历史数据追溯:备份数据不仅用于恢复,还可以作为历史数据查询和分析的依据
在某些情况下,企业可能需要回溯过去的数据以解决问题或进行决策支持,备份数据为此提供了可能
二、易语言环境下ACCESS数据库备份的实施方法 在易语言环境中,备份ACCESS数据库可以通过编写脚本或调用外部工具来实现
以下介绍几种常用的备份方法: 1.手动备份: - 直接复制数据库文件:最基础的备份方式,通过文件管理器手动复制`.accdb`或`.mdb`文件到安全存储位置
虽然操作简单,但依赖人工操作,易出错且不够及时
- 使用ACCESS自带的“备份数据库”功能:在ACCESS软件内,通过“文件”菜单选择“备份数据库”,指定备份位置和文件名即可
此方法较为直观,适合小规模或低频备份需求
2.自动化备份脚本: - 易语言编写备份脚本:利用易语言的文件操作函数,如`文件复制`、`创建目录`等,编写一个自动化备份脚本
可以设置定时任务,定期执行备份操作,提高备份的效率和可靠性
- 结合外部工具(如Windows任务计划程序):编写好备份脚本后,通过Windows自带的任务计划程序设置定时任务,实现无人值守的自动备份
这种方法结合了易语言的灵活性和Windows系统的任务调度能力,是较为推荐的备份方案
3.第三方备份软件: - 选择支持ACCESS数据库的备份软件,如一些专业的数据库管理工具或企业级的备份解决方案
这些软件通常提供图形化界面,易于配置和管理,且支持多种备份策略(如全量备份、增量备份、差异备份),满足不同层次的数据保护需求
三、最佳实践与建议 1.制定备份策略:根据数据的重要性和变化频率,制定合理的备份计划
例如,对核心业务数据实施每日全量备份,辅以定期(如每周)的增量备份;对非核心业务数据,则可考虑更长周期的备份策略
2.验证备份有效性:备份完成后,应定期进行备份数据的验证,确保备份文件可用且数据完整
这可以通过尝试恢复备份数据到测试环境来完成
3.存储安全:备份数据应存储在物理位置或网络位置与原始数据库分离的安全区域,以防止单点故障
同时,考虑使用加密技术保护备份数据的安全,防止数据泄露
4.灾难恢复计划:结合数据库备份,制定详细的灾难恢复计划,包括数据恢复流程、责任分配、恢复时间目标(RTO)和恢复点目标(RPO)等
定期进行灾难恢复演练,确保在真实事件发生时能够迅速响应
5.监控与报警:实施备份监控机制,监控备份任务的执行状态、备份数据的完整性和存储空间的使用情况
一旦发现异常,立即触发报警,以便及时采取措施
6.持续学习与优化:随着业务的发展和技术的演进,定期评估备份策略的有效性,根据实际需求进行调整和优化
同时,关注最新的数据保护技术和最佳实践,不断提升数据保护能力
结语 在易语言环境下实施ACCESS数据库的备份工作,是确保数据安全、提升业务连续性的重要基石
通过合理的备份策略、自动化的备份脚本、安全的存储管理以及完善的灾难恢复计划,企业可以有效降低数据丢失的风险,保障业务的稳定运行
面对日益复杂的数据环境,持续学习和优化备份策略,将是企业在数字化转型道路上不可或缺的能力
让我们携手并进,共同守护数据的安全,为企业的长远发展保驾护航